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41177 59789307577 44332599
893147638 320704228 696
893147638 320704228 696
7600405961 60188431 505844
All about undefined
Interested in learning more?
893147638 320704228 696
7600405961 60188431 505844
See more
907638 309
116 3607733 474180
See more
23589934702 34
2483507403 1905 70611032 76595185
See more